В экосистеме сайта GitHub имеется специальный репозитарий, в котором хранятся иконки для основных языков программирования и многих известных проектов, нарисованных и опубликованных под свободной лицензией MIT. Иконки хранятся в формате SVG.
Адрес репозитария:
https://github.com/devicons/devicon
Предполагается, что иконки в этом репозитарии, один раз появившись, никуда не перемещаются. Поэтому их можно использовать, как минимум, при оформлении страниц README для собствственных репозитариев любого пользователя.
Чтобы просмотреть возможные иконки в браузере, можно прыгать по подкаталогам и нажимать на *.svg-файлы. Однако для удобства использования был создан специальный родственный сайт-проект:
https://devicon.dev/
Группы иконок представлены в виде табличного списка:

Выбрав группу иконок, справа можно выбрать вариант (стиль) иконки - в светлых тонах, в темных тонах, цветной, черно-белый варианты. После чего можно скопировать ссылку на нужную картику.
Соответствие адресов на devicon.dev и github.com следующее:
https://cdn.jsdelivr.net/gh/devicons/devicon@latest/icons/python/python-original.svg
https://raw.githubusercontent.com/devicons/devicon/master/icons/python/python-original.svg
Использовать этот адрес в README можно следующим образом:
<img src="https://raw.githubusercontent.com/devicons/devicon/master/icons/python/python-original.svg" alt="python" width="128" height="128"/>
Выглядеть иконка будет примерно так:

Таким способом можно добавлять в описание проекта необходимые пиктограммы, которые сразу будут бросаться в глаза, обеспечивая тем самым быстрое понимание, какие технологии использует тот или иной проект.